I am trying to acheive the following:
clienta has lots of data and small files, I cannot get it to complete inside the backup window. I am using Windows Policy type as dont have Windows Flash backup lic.
backup f:\data\D* in a policy (it has many folders begining with D don't want to have many policies)
backup f:\data\Daily\Huge in a seperate policy
using the client exclude properties: exclude f:\data\Daily\Huge from the first policy so it doesn't backup twice.
Create new policy backup_clienta_D for clienta:
backup selecion: f:\data\D*
Create a new policy backup_clienta_D_Huge for a huge subfolder of clienta:
backup selection f:\data\Daily\Huge
Excude f:\data\Daily\Huge from policy backup_clienta_D
I cannot get the syntax correct.
I have reviewed http://www.symantec.com/docs/HOWTO34243 and the admin guide but cannot see what I am doing wrong.

Below the Exclude Lists pane, click Add
then select the Policy
backup_clienta_D
select the Schedule
<<All Schedules>>
then enter the Files/Directories
f:\data\Daily\Huge
and click Add and then OK
(all of this is under Host Properties and not in the Policy, by the way)
